First, f is concave down from x=-1.5 to 1.5, since the slope (shown by f') is decreasing for that interval. So the first choice is false.
Since the slope hits a relative minimum at x=1.5 with the slope decreasing on the interval (1.5,1.5) and increasing for x>1.5, there is indeed an inflection point there. So the second choice is true.
Finally, since the slope is negative as x approaches 2 from the left and positive from the right, we see that f does have a relative minimum at x=2. So the third choice is true.
Since the second and third choices are true, not all choices are false. So the correct answer is the first choice.
